There is a 'wart' in the windows version. All the parsing is done in our code EXCEPT for the HEVC parsing, which instead uses NVDec. The problem is that we don't have NVDec for DGIndexNV linux. So what I did is replace the NVDec parsing in the windows version with our own parsing. It works just fine...

I did the first one, the front-end FM IF can. Radio still works and I thought I was gonna get lucky but it started thunderstorming again after 5 hours. So now I'm gonna do the front end AM IF can. Note that these two IF cans have windings in series, so if one is bad it will affect both FM and AM. I ...
